Warning signs
Spot the problem early
Car Bumped a Bottom Panel
Accidental contact with a vehicle can dent or crack the lowest section of the garage door, compromising its appearance.
Cracked or Rotted Section
Older wood doors, common in areas like Swainwood, can show signs of rot or stress cracks over time due to weather exposure.
Hail or Windstorm Damage
Severe Chicagoland weather can dent or warp metal panels across any garage door, reducing its insulation and visual appeal.
Top Panel Bowed from Opener Strain
An improperly adjusted or aging garage door opener can put excessive stress on the top panel, causing it to bow or bend.
Visible Rust or Corrosion
Metal panels, especially in humid or salty conditions, can develop rust which weakens the material and looks unsightly.
How it works
- 01
Assessment and Quote
We inspect the damaged panel and the surrounding sections. We provide an upfront, flat-rate quote for the replacement before any work begins.
- 02
Panel Sourcing and Preparation
We source a replacement panel that matches your existing door's color, texture, and insulation. Our trucks stock common parts for faster service.
- 03
Installation and Reinforcement
Our technicians remove the damaged panel and install the new section. We install new hinges, fasteners, and reinforcement struts as needed.
- 04
Safety and Balance Testing
After installation, we perform a full balance test. We also check the garage door's safety-reverse mechanism to ensure proper operation.

Glenview panel replacement questions
How much does a garage door panel replacement cost in Glenview?
Typical panel replacement costs in Glenview range from $250 to $800 per panel, installed. The final price depends on the panel's size, material, and insulation R-value. High-end insulated doors or full-view glass panels, common in areas like The Glen, may be at the higher end of this range due to specialized parts. We provide a precise, upfront flat-rate quote before beginning any work.

How long does a panel replacement take for Glenview homes?
Most garage door panel replacements for Glenview residences can be completed in a single visit, typically within 2-4 hours. Our service trucks are stocked with common parts, which helps expedite the repair process. The exact time can vary depending on the panel type, the extent of the damage, and if any additional structural reinforcement like struts or hinges are also needed.
Is a damaged garage door panel in Glenview an emergency repair?
Generally, a single damaged panel is not an emergency repair. Your garage door usually remains functional and secure. We are open 24 hours Monday through Saturday for urgent issues, but panel replacement typically falls under scheduled service. If the damage is severe enough to prevent the door from operating safely or securing your property, we recommend calling us to discuss your specific situation.
